/**
 * Hosted Claude tool-use loop runtime (migration 0069).
 *
 * Users paste a JavaScript/TypeScript snippet at /connect/claude/deploy
 * that drives Anthropic's SDK however they want — typically a tool-use
 * loop calling Gluecron MCP tools. We persist the source, mint an agent
 * session for budget enforcement, and execute the snippet on demand in
 * a sandboxed Bun subprocess.
 *
 * Design rules
 * ─────────────
 *   - Best-effort DB: every read/write is wrapped so missing tables
 *     (migration 0069 not yet applied) degrade to `null` / `[]`. The
 *     routes layer turns null into a 404, the wizard hides the section.
 *   - Sandboxed exec: we never `eval()`. The source is written to a temp
 *     file and run with `bun run --no-install <file>` in a *separate
 *     process* with a 30s hard timeout. The subprocess inherits a
 *     scrubbed env (no Postgres URL, no SMTP creds) and only sees the
 *     three vars it needs.
 *   - Budget meter: each invocation captures the JSON usage block that
 *     the snippet prints (or that we extract from stdout) and pipes the
 *     numbers through `recordAiCost` + `chargeAgent`. Over-budget
 *     invocations short-circuit with a `budget_exceeded` status.
 *   - Test seam: callers can inject `__setExecutorForTests` to bypass
 *     the subprocess and assert tracker behaviour without Bun shell
 *     side effects.
 */

/**
 * Best-effort parser: find the FIRST JSON object printed in stdout that
 * contains a `usage` block with input/output tokens. Returns zeros when
 * nothing matches. The intent is to encourage snippets to emit something
 * like `console.log(JSON.stringify({ usage: response.usage, ... }))`.
 */
export function extractUsageFromStdout(stdout: string): {
  inputTokens: number;
  outputTokens: number;
  model: string | null;
} {
  if (!stdout) return { inputTokens: 0, outputTokens: 0, model: null };
  // Try whole-stdout-is-json first.
  const tryParse = (chunk: string) => {
    try {
      const parsed = JSON.parse(chunk);
      if (parsed && typeof parsed === "object") return parsed;
    } catch {
      /* ignore */
    }
    return null;
  };
  const candidates: unknown[] = [];
  const whole = tryParse(stdout.trim());
  if (whole) candidates.push(whole);
  // Fall back to line-by-line.
  for (const line of stdout.split(/\n/)) {
    const t = line.trim();
    if (!t.startsWith("{")) continue;
    const got = tryParse(t);
    if (got) candidates.push(got);
  }
  for (const c of candidates) {
    const obj = c as Record<string, unknown>;
    const usage = obj.usage as Record<string, unknown> | undefined;
    if (
      usage &&
      typeof usage.input_tokens === "number" &&
      typeof usage.output_tokens === "number"
    ) {
      return {
        inputTokens: usage.input_tokens,
        outputTokens: usage.output_tokens,
        model: typeof obj.model === "string" ? obj.model : null,
      };
    }
  }
  return { inputTokens: 0, outputTokens: 0, model: null };
}

/**
 * Spawn the user's snippet in a fresh Bun subprocess. The snippet is
 * written to a tempdir and removed when we're done. The subprocess
 * sees only the env vars we pass — `process.env` is NOT inherited.
 */
async function defaultExecutor(args: ExecArgs): Promise<ExecResult> {
  const started = Date.now();
  const dir = await mkdtemp(join(tmpdir(), "gluecron-cldploy-"));
  const file = join(dir, "loop.mjs");
  await writeFile(file, args.sourceCode, "utf8");

  let timedOut = false;
  let killTimer: ReturnType<typeof setTimeout> | null = null;
  let escalateTimer: ReturnType<typeof setTimeout> | null = null;
  let proc: ReturnType<typeof Bun.spawn> | null = null;
  try {
    proc = Bun.spawn(["bun", "run", "--no-install", file], {
      cwd: dir,
      stdout: "pipe",
      stderr: "pipe",
      env: {
        ...args.env,
        INPUT: JSON.stringify(args.inputPayload ?? {}),
      },
    });

    killTimer = setTimeout(() => {
      timedOut = true;
      try {
        proc?.kill("SIGTERM");
      } catch {
        /* ignore */
      }
      escalateTimer = setTimeout(() => {
        try {
          proc?.kill("SIGKILL");
        } catch {
          /* ignore */
        }
      }, KILL_GRACE_MS);
    }, LOOP_EXEC_TIMEOUT_MS);

    const stdoutP = proc.stdout
      ? new Response(proc.stdout as ReadableStream).text().catch(() => "")
      : Promise.resolve("");
    const stderrP = proc.stderr
      ? new Response(proc.stderr as ReadableStream).text().catch(() => "")
      : Promise.resolve("");
    const [stdout, stderr] = await Promise.all([stdoutP, stderrP]);
    const exitCode = await proc.exited;

    return {
      stdout,
      stderr: timedOut
        ? `${stderr}\n[killed after ${LOOP_EXEC_TIMEOUT_MS}ms timeout]`
        : stderr,
      exitCode,
      durationMs: Date.now() - started,
      timedOut,
    };
  } catch (err) {
    return {
      stdout: "",
      stderr: `[hosted-claude-loop] spawn failed: ${(err as Error).message}`,
      exitCode: null,
      durationMs: Date.now() - started,
      timedOut: false,
    };
  } finally {
    if (killTimer) clearTimeout(killTimer);
    if (escalateTimer) clearTimeout(escalateTimer);
    await rm(dir, { recursive: true, force: true }).catch(() => undefined);
  }
}
